    Lava Furnace - Furnaces that run on lava:

    The basic idea of this plugin is to allow players to create a furnace that will run on lava but not consume buckets. It allows for customization by admins for fuel burn time, cook time, per player cook times and amount of furnaces per player. It is by default pretty balanced, but is customizable by admins for personal preference in balancing or even cheating if you so choose.

    Features:
    • User created Furnaces that consume only the lava not the bucket
    • Also can be used with regular fuel sources through the Minecraft furnace interface.
    • Potential to create infinitely fueled furnaces via config file
    • Can set furnace burn times up to 2147483647 via config
    • Can set furnace cook times from 1 to 4 x normal speed via config
    • Can define the blocks a furnace is created from via config
    • Works with multi-worlds
    • Permissions via PermissionsEX, GroupManager, nijikokun based permissions, bukkit permissions or OPs
    • Lava level is easily viewable through glass door and changes with burn time of furnace
    • Optional small or large Production Chests (*based on Zarius's idea)
    • Optional Custom Smelt-ables via config
    • Production chest smelt priority from TOP LEFT to BOTTOM RIGHT
    • Per user cook times, per item cook times from 1 to 4 x normal speed via commands
    • Per player group build limits

    Shadow771

    A cool idea would be if you built the furnace over a lava lake, it'll use that as its fuel. It'll remove 1 block of lava per 128 uses or something like that, possibly a variable. Once the lava lake has run dry you'll have to fuel it normally. This would be awesome for underground houses, simply build a furnace over a lava lake and you have an instant fuel source.
     
  8. Offline

    Arcwolf

    @Shadow771 Yea I though of that already... was actually my original idea but I couldnt figure out how to drain the lake of lava. The whole infinite lava thing stumped me. Lava lakes can take up more then a few chunks and draining a HUGE lake of lava would really impact server performance. So in the end I settled for this.

    Maybe one day when finite liquids are implemented something like the Dwarf Fortress lava furnace will be possible. (my original inspiration)
